DH Custom Rods & Tackle is located in Wayzata and offers to show you a memorable time in these waters. Come fish with some of the best in the Midwest. Lake Minnetonka is one of the best, most underrated fishing lakes in the land of 10,000 lakes. Lake Mille Lacs trips can be accommodated with sleeping quarters at an additional cost. Your crew can work with large corporate events and even coordinate tournament-style competitive trips as a fun event.
Capt. Dusty will do his best to make sure you have a fun day full of fishing. This involves 4 to 7-hour trips, mainly fishing for Bass both largemouth and small. Sunfish, Muskellunge, Pike, Crappie, and Walleye, depending on the season and conditions on the day. On these trips, you can expect to use techniques such as light tackle, trolling, ice fishing, jigging, and spinning.
Your fishing adventure starts on a 23’ Mako boat that can safely take up to 6 anglers. This boat comes with an ice-box and a wireless trolling motor.
All rods, reels, and terminal tackle are included in the price so you can focus on what really matters, fishing. Please make sure to buy a valid fishing license ahead of time. The boat will be supplied with drinks for your pleasure, be sure to let the captain know if you have any questions or want to bring your own.
